--- src/sys/dev/raid/ips/ips_disk.c 2007/06/17 23:50:16 1.13 +++ src/sys/dev/raid/ips/ips_disk.c 2008/06/10 17:20:52 1.14 @@ -140,7 +140,7 @@ ipsd_strategy(struct dev_strategy_args * bio->bio_driver_info = dsc; devstat_start_transaction(&dsc->stats); lockmgr(&dsc->sc->queue_lock, LK_EXCLUSIVE|LK_RETRY); - bioq_insert_tail(&dsc->sc->bio_queue, bio); + bioqdisksort(&dsc->sc->bio_queue, bio); ips_start_io_request(dsc->sc); lockmgr(&dsc->sc->queue_lock, LK_RELEASE); return(0);